idhddlmZmZmZmZmZGddeZGddeeZGddeeeZy) )Plugin RedHatPlugin DebianPlugin UbuntuPlugin PluginOptc0eZdZdZdZdZedddgZy) Pxez PXE servicepxe)sysmgmtnetworktftpbootFz"collect content from tftpboot path)defaultdescN)__name__ __module__ __qualname__ short_desc plugin_nameprofilesr option_list8/usr/lib/python3/dist-packages/sos/report/plugins/pxe.pyr r s'JK%H*e; =Krr c&eZdZdZdZfdZxZS) RedHatPxe)z/usr/sbin/pxeos)zsystem-config-netboot-cmdctt| |jd|j d|j dr|j dyy)Nz/usr/sbin/pxeos -lz/etc/dhcpd.confr z /tftpboot)superrsetupadd_cmd_output add_copy_spec get_optionself __class__s rrzRedHatPxe.setupsM i$& 01 ,- ??: &   { + 'r)rrrfilespackagesr __classcell__r$s@rrrs E-H,,rrc"eZdZdZfdZxZS) DebianPxe)z tftpd-hpactt| |jddg|j dr|jdyy)Nz/etc/dhcp/dhcpd.confz/etc/default/tftpd-hpar z/var/lib/tftpboot)rr*rr r!r"s rrzDebianPxe.setup)sK i$&  " $   ??: &   2 3 'r)rrrr&rr'r(s@rr*r*%sH44rr*N) sos.report.pluginsrrrrrr rr*rrrr-s999& ,\ , 4\< 4r